Ruby The Hatchet Release Organ-Driven New Song “Killer”

New Jersey psychedelic stoner metal band and Converse Rubber Tracks x MetalSucks alumnus Ruby the Hatchet have announced their third LP, called Planetary Space Child. Practically every aspect of that sentence appeals itself to a very specific audience, and anyone that is part of that demographic is sure to love this upcoming record.

The album will be released August 25 this year via Tee Pee, and its lead single has already been released. “KILLER” features some pretty prominent organ harmonies that hold up the groove metal riffs that act as the skeleton to the track.

Even the album cover to the upcoming record shouts “extreme,” with a nude lady rocketing through space like a comet alongside two oxen, a skull-faced devil figure, and an alien merman holding a spear.

Ruby the Hatchet has previously been featured at the Zakk Sabbath Halloween Night, and performed at this year’s phenomenal Roadburn festival in the Netherlands earlier this April.
